260 Workers Trapped in South African Gold Mine Await Rescue

260 workers have been trapped in a gold mine in South Africa for nearly a day. A larger rescue operation is underway to retrieve them from there, announces the mining company Sibanye Stillwater.

An initial investigation suggests that damage in the mine shaft occurred when a hatch was opened at the Kloof mine west of Johannesburg.

"Following a detailed risk assessment, it was decided that employees would remain at the mine station until it is safe to proceed further up, to avoid traveling long distances at present," the company writes in a statement.

According to the trade union NUM, which represents the workers at Kloof, they have been trapped for nearly a day.

We are very concerned since the mine has not even disclosed this incident until we informed the media, says spokesperson Livhuwani Mammburu.

According to the company, all miners are safe and will be able to be retrieved on Friday.
